What is B2B Lead Generation?
B2B lead generation involves identifying and attracting organizations (not individuals) as prospective buyers of your product or service. It’s the critical first pillar of revenue growth for business-to-business companies—from SaaS startups to global enterprises.
Key characteristics:
- Complex buyer journey: Multiple stakeholders and decision-makers
- Longer sales cycles: Deals take months, not days
- High lifetime value: Each deal can mean six or seven figures over time
Types of B2B Leads
| Lead Type | Description |
|---|---|
| Marketing Qualified (MQL) | Engaged with marketing, not yet sales-ready |
| Sales Qualified (SQL) | Scored and vetted, ready for direct sales outreach |
| Product Qualified (PQL) | Engaged through product trial/use (common in SaaS) |
| Service Qualified | Ready for solution scoping or service engagement |

Why does lead generation matter? According to Salesgenie, companies with mature lead gen systems see up to 24% faster three-year revenue growth and a 27% boost in profit versus their competitors.
Market Overview & Problem Definition
The State of B2B Lead Generation in 2025
The B2B landscape is powerful but turbulent:
- Market size: The global lead gen market will hit $32.1B by 2035 (Yahoo Finance).
- Volume gap: Median B2B businesses gained just 27 new leads per month in 2024, compared to B2C’s 196 (Databox).
- Top priorities:
- 91% of marketers say lead gen is their #1 goal (ReachMarketing).
- 68% of companies struggle with quality or quantity of leads.
Main Problems B2B Organizations Face
- Lead Quality vs. Quantity: More is not always better. Bad leads waste sales time.
- Channel Overload: Should you double down on outbound, inbound, ABM, or something else?
- Budget Cuts: Nearly 48% of marketing teams saw budget cuts in 2025 (Martal).
- Data Privacy & Compliance: New regulations mean opt-in, permission-based models.
- Fragmented Tech Stack: Tool sprawl leads to inefficiency and poor ROI.

Key B2B Lead Generation Strategies
High-performing B2B organizations use a mix of inbound, outbound, and technology-enhanced methods to build a healthy pipeline.
1. Inbound Marketing
Inbound lead generation attracts prospects by delivering valuable content, resources, and tools to solve their problems.
Tactics That Work:
- Content Marketing: Blogs, whitepapers, guides, ebooks
- SEO & SEM: Capture high-intent searches; optimize for featured snippets (42% of leads come from search)
- Webinars & Virtual Events: 51% of B2B marketers say webinars are a top lead driver (Root Digital)
- Social Media: LinkedIn is king. 89% of B2B marketers cite it as the most effective channel.
Example:
A cybersecurity firm published a technical whitepaper on ransomware defense. PPC ads and LinkedIn promotion drove 3,800 downloads, resulting in 180+ SQLs in 60 days, all tracked with UTM and CRM integration.
2. Outbound Prospecting
Outbound lead generation proactively targets and contacts prospects via channels such as:
- Cold Email: Still delivers ROI when personalized
- Phone Outreach: For high-value/enterprise accounts
- Social Selling: Direct LinkedIn InMail or connection strategies
- Direct Mail & Gifting: For ABM or high-value deals

Tip: Use multi-touch sequences—combining emails, calls, and social—to stand out and increase response rates up to 52% (Sopro.io).
3. Account-Based Marketing (ABM)
ABM aligns sales and marketing to target specific, high-value accounts:
- Laser-focused personalization
- Custom landing pages/content
- 1:1 relationship building with key stakeholders
ABM Payoff:
- Companies with aligned ABM grow revenues 24% faster (Salesgenie).
4. AI and Automation
AI is rapidly transforming B2B lead generation:
- Predictive Scoring: Surface leads most likely to convert
- Intent Data: Detect buyer signals online
- Chatbots & Conversational AI: Qualify leads 24/7
- Automated Outreach Sequences: Personalize at scale
Example: PepperInsight.com leverages AI to scan 1 million news articles daily, extracting leads and generating personalized outreach at scale across 40 countries.
5. Content Syndication
Syndicating valuable gated content through trusted business media can grow your pipeline reliably, especially in regulated or niche B2B verticals.
6. Events and Webinars
These drive both brand awareness and direct SQL generation, with 52% of marketers citing events as a core pipeline driver (Root Digital).

Top Challenges and Smart Solutions
Challenge #1: Low Lead Quality
Solution:
- Implement AI-powered lead scoring to weed out unqualified contacts
- Enrich data from third-party sources
- Align sales and marketing on definitions and qualification criteria
Challenge #2: Data Privacy and Compliance
Solution:
- Double down on opt-in, permission-based lead capture
- Use CRM/CDP tools to manage and update consent
Challenge #3: Sales/Marketing Alignment
Solution:
- Weekly cross-department syncs on ICP and pipeline status
- Shared CRM dashboards and SLAs
Challenge #4: Tool Overload
Solution:
- Audit your martech stack for ROI
- Centralize data in a single source of truth (CRM/CDP)
Challenge #5: Declining Outbound Response Rates
Solution:
- Layer personalization with intent data
- Use multi-touch sequences: combine email, LinkedIn, phone, and video
Best Practices and Implementation Guide
Building a World-Class B2B Lead Generation Engine
1. Develop a Precise Ideal Customer Profile (ICP)
- Analyze existing high-value customers
- Use firmographics (industry, size, revenue), technographics, and behavioral data
2. Map the Full Buyer Journey
- Awareness > Consideration > Decision > Post-Sale
- Identify content/opportunity touchpoints at each stage
3. Content That Converts
- Develop thought leadership (blogs, webinars, industry reports)
- Use gated content for lead capture, but provide real value
- Optimize for SEO; target keywords buyers actually search
4. Integrate Multi-Channel Outreach
- Inbound (SEO, content, paid, webinars)
- Outbound (cold email, calls, LinkedIn, ABM)
- Events (virtual and in-person)
5. Install Closed-Loop Reporting
- Sync marketing and sales data in the CRM
- Regular pipeline reviews and attribution analysis
6. Nurture and Qualify
- Email automation for lead nurture
- AI chatbots to qualify leads in real time
7. Continuous Test & Optimize
- A/B test subject lines, landing pages, ads
- Review campaigns weekly for cost-per-lead and SQL conversion
Pro Tips:
- Personalization is the difference-maker: AI + intent data = higher replies and meetings set.
- Sales and marketing must collaborate: Define what a qualified lead looks like and hand off smoothly.
- Leverage data from every channel: Even lost deals offer insights.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. What is the difference between B2B and B2C lead generation?
B2B focuses on other businesses as buyers (longer cycles, larger deals, multi-stakeholder buying), while B2C targets individuals (shorter cycles, more emotional decisions).
2. What are the most effective channels for B2B lead generation in 2025?
LinkedIn, content marketing, AI-driven email and social outreach, webinars, and ABM campaigns. In-person events and video also play a key role.
3. How does AI help with B2B lead generation?
AI surfaces high-intent accounts, automates outreach, personalizes messages, scores leads, and powers chatbots/conversational marketing. This boosts both quality and efficiency.
4. Why are MQLs and SQLs important?
They help align sales and marketing, define what constitutes a qualified lead, and ensure good deals aren’t lost in handoff.
5. How can sales and marketing teams work better together on lead gen?
Shared data, weekly pipeline reviews, agreed-upon definitions (ICPs, lead stages), and transparent feedback loops are vital.
6. What KPIs should I measure?
- Cost per Lead (CPL)
- Marketing Qualified Leads (MQLs)
- Sales Qualified Leads (SQLs)
- Lead-to-customer rate
- Pipeline velocity
- Lifetime value and ROI by channel
7. Is outbound still worth it?
Absolutely—if you personalize, leverage intent signals, and sequence outreach. Generic outbound is less effective every year.
8. How important is content quality in 2025?
It’s everything. Buyers consume 5–7 pieces of content before engaging sales, and trust is won by being genuinely helpful, specific, and original.
